Comparable RFQ fields
Use the same requirements when comparing products and supplier quotes.
| Parameter | What to compare | Why it matters |
|---|---|---|
| Viscosity range | Formula behavior at relevant conditions | It affects priming, output and recovery. |
| Pump and neck | Engine, actuator, closure and bottle interface | A pump title alone does not prove fit. |
| Dip tube | Material, length, cut and reach | Geometry affects residual and repeat dose. |
| Fill-line fit | Bottle dimensions, neck, torque and stability | The selected pack must work with the intended process. |

Validation before production
Select checks from the formula, dispensing, appearance, handling and transport risks of the actual project.
Measure startup and repeat dose with the formula.
Observe recovery, clogging and residual at relevant conditions.
Assess the closed pack and transport orientation.
Run representative line or manual-assembly checks.

Read technical articleStart with formula viscosity, target output, neck, fill volume, consumer use and filling process, then request the matched pump and dip tube.
A nominal neck reference is not enough. Confirm thread, sealing, engine, gasket, dip tube, closure height and assembled performance.
Length and cut affect assembly, bottom reach, product access, priming and residual in the selected bottle.
Water may support an initial mechanical check but does not represent every formula. Final decisions need the intended formula or a justified test medium.
Include formula type, viscosity, fill volume, target output, neck, pump, lock, tube, decoration, quantity, filling location and destination.
Collection buyer guide
A useful pump brief connects formula, dose, bottle geometry and filling.
Record viscosity and target output under relevant conditions.
Freeze bottle, neck, engine, actuator, gasket and tube.
Check priming, dose, lock, leakage and residual with the filled pack.
